### Action Item: Spoolhaven Retry Storm

From last Tuesday's outage: the Spoolhaven print service retried failed jobs without backoff, saturating the render pool. Fix merged; retries now use capped exponential backoff with jitter. Owner will monitor for a week before closing. The agreed retry constants are recorded below.

constants for yadup-kajof:
RATE_LIMITS = {
    "zorwyn": 1,
    "druwyn": 1,
}

MEMO — Gross-Margin Review. All branch managers: the quarterly margin review for Tallgrove Retail Group is complete. Margins on the Fennick appliance line slipped 2.4 points, driven by freight costs and markdowns at the Dunmere and Caswick branches. Corrective pricing takes effect on the first of the month; discounting authority above 10% now requires regional sign-off. Please brief floor supervisors accordingly. The strategic rationale is noted below.

confidential, kagup-bafog: Fraaxax Group is in early talks to buy Soroxox Group for about $343.8 million. The Olidor launch date is June 14, and nothing goes to the press before then. Legal wants the Aldmirek Logistics term sheet signed before July 23.

FINANCE REVIEW SUMMARY — Sales Leads, Dunmere Analytics

Quick one on the Lanternfield retirement. The line's been running at negative margin for three quarters, and renewal volume keeps sliding, so we're sunsetting it end of next fiscal year. Existing customers get migration credits toward Skyvane Pro — use them in your renewal conversations. No new Lanternfield deals from next month. Comp plans adjust accordingly; Priya will walk you through it. There's one more thing, strictly confidential.

board note of hahif-yahaf: Only 36 of the 571 pilot accounts renewed Noveth, so a churn review is set for September 26. Briwynax Group is in early talks to buy Aldvanix Logistics for about $104.9 million.